Determining your monthly premium depends on a few straightforward factors. Insurance carriers look at your current age, your overall health history, and the specific amount of coverage you want to leave behind for your family. Generally, non-smokers who are in good health see lower rates. If you have pre-existing health conditions, that can change the quote, though options still exist. Final expense burial insurance for seniors is a type of whole life insurance policy designed to cover the costs associated with a funeral, burial, and other end-of-life expenses. These policies typically have smaller death benefits, ranging from a few thousand dollars up to a certain limit, and often feature simplified underwriting, meaning fewer health questions are asked. This makes them accessible for seniors who may have pre-existing health conditions. The benefit is paid to beneficiaries to cover these specific costs.
